{"data":{"id":"us-ky/krs-386.030","jurisdiction":"us-ky","citation":"KRS 386.030","heading":"Investment of funds of financial institutions and funds in hands of","body":"public officials.\n(1) Banks, trust companies, insurance companies, savings and loan associations,\nexecutors, administrators, trustees or others acting in a fiduciary capacity, trust\nfunds, and other financial institutions, originating mortgagee institutions, and\nother institutions approved  as  mortgagees  and  meeting otherwise the\nrequirements of the secretary of housing and urban development, the Federal\nHousing Administration or Department of Veterans Affairs to act as mortgagees\nunder that agency's approval program, subject to the laws of this state, may:\n(a) Make  such loans and advances of credit and purchases of obligations\nrepresenting loans and advances of credit as are eligible for credit\ninsurance  or  guaranty by  the secretary of housing  and  urban\ndevelopment,  the federal housing administrator or administrator of\nveterans' affairs, and may  obtain such insurance, guaranty or other\napproval;\n(b) Make  such loans secured by real property or leasehold, as the secretary\nof housing and urban development, the federal housing administrator or\nadministrator of veterans' affairs insures or issues a guaranty or makes a\ncommitment  to insure, or guaranty, and may obtain such insurance, or\nguaranty;\n(c) Invest their funds, eligible for investment, in notes or bonds secured by\nmortgage or trust deed insured by the secretary of housing and urban\ndevelopment,  the federal housing administrator or administrator of\nveterans' affairs, and in debentures issued by the secretary of housing\nand  urban  development,  the  federal housing  administrator or\nadministrator of veterans' affairs, and also in securities issued by national\nmortgage associations; and\n(d) Invest their funds in real estate mortgage notes, bonds  and  other\ninterest-bearing or dividend-paying securities (including securities of any\nopen-end  or closed-end management  type investment company  or\ninvestment trust registered under the Federal Investment Company  Act of\n1940)  which would be regarded by prudent businessmen as a safe\ninvestment. The  fact that the persons listed in this subsection are\nproviding services to the foregoing investment company  or trust as\ninvestment advisor, custodian, transfer agent, registrar or otherwise shall\nnot preclude such persons from investing in the securities of such\ninvestment company or trust.\n(2) This state and any of its political subdivisions, or any agency or instrumentality\nthereof may  invest its funds and the moneys  in its custody or possession,\neligible for investment, in notes or bonds described in paragraph (c) of\nsubsection (1) of this section.\n(3) No  law of this state requiring security upon which loans or investments may be\nmade, or prescribing the nature, amount or form of the security, or prescribing\nor limiting interest rates upon loans or investments, or limiting investments of\ncapital or deposits, or prescribing or limiting the period for which loans or\ninvestments may be made, shall apply to loans or investments made pursuant\nto this section.","path":["KRS Chapter 386"],"source_url":"https://apps.legislature.ky.gov/law/statutes/statute.aspx?id=45845","current_through":"Includes enactments through the 2026 Regular Session","vintage":"09/05/2026","retrieved_at":"2026-09-05T20:59:15Z","sha256":"58de582e752c092ace9d52d8898a6803fa470a08026a6d2a184106215b608fa0","source_id":"us-ky","stale":false,"prev":"us-ky/krs-386.025","next":"us-ky/krs-386.040"},"notice":"GroundRules: Original legal text.
